Roblox Jailbreak Trading Network: Blue 2 (Color) Value Changes

Blue 2 (Color) From Roblox Jailbreak | Sourced From Jailbreak Trading Network.
Blue 2 (Color) From Roblox Jailbreak | Sourced From Jailbreak Trading Network.
  • Regular value increased: $4,000,000 → $4,500,000.
  • Duped value increased: $3,500,000 → $4,000,000.

Additional Item Information:

Blue 2, commonly discussed as Hyper Blue at level 2 in the Jailbreak Trading Expansion, is a progressive hyperchrome-style cosmetic that represents an early evolved stage of the blue variant. In-game it reads as a vivid blue reactive finish that feels more “alive” than a flat paint, with a glossy, energy-like sheen that shifts as lighting changes. The look is most noticeable on broad vehicle panels where the blue glow can roll across curves, while smaller surfaces can make the effect appear tighter and more concentrated. Its identity is tied to the Cargo Plane robbery line, with progression driven by repeated heists rather than a one-time purchase or seasonal unlock. The original path to obtain and evolve it is grinding the Cargo Plane, and the practical requirement to reach this stage is about 500 heists. Because the plane departs infrequently compared to other robbery loops, many players consider Hyper Blue among the most time-consuming hyperchromes to unlock, and that time-gate shapes its rarity perception. In Trading Island and Jailbreak Trading, Blue 2 is treated as a limited-by-effort collectible rather than a limited-by-date item, meaning it can still be pursued through gameplay but remains scarce due to the long grind. Current acquisition methods outside direct progression are primarily trading, and its collector framing is reinforced by a Collector Rarity Score of 256, signaling that it sits in a higher-tier collector bracket even without public demand or distribution figures.
